Aryes Recipe (Crispy Middle Eastern Meat-Stuffed Pita)
Prep Time: 20 minutes
Cook Time: 15 minutes
Total Time: 35 minutes
Servings: 4

Ingredients
For the Filling
- 400 g ground lamb or beef
- 1 small onion, finely grated
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 2 tablespoons chopped parsley
- 1 teaspoon paprika
- ½ teaspoon cumin
- ½ teaspoon ground coriander
- ½ teaspoon black pepper
- ¾ teaspoon salt
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
For the Bread
- 4 pita breads
Optional for Serving
- Tahini sauce
- Yogurt dip
- Sliced tomatoes
- Fresh parsley
- Lemon wedges
Instructions
Step 1: Prepare the Meat Mixture
In a bowl, combine ground meat, onion, garlic, parsley, paprika, cumin, coriander, black pepper, salt, and olive oil. Mix thoroughly until well combined.
Step 2: Prepare the Pita Bread
Cut each pita bread in half to form pockets.
Step 3: Stuff the Pita
Fill each pita pocket with a thin layer of the meat mixture. Spread the filling evenly inside the bread.
Step 4: Cook the Aryes
You can cook Aryes in three ways:
Oven Method:
Preheat oven to 200°C (400°F). Place stuffed pitas on a baking tray and bake for 12–15 minutes until crispy and cooked through.
Pan Method:
Heat a skillet over medium heat and cook the stuffed pitas for 5–6 minutes per side.
Grill Method:
Grill for 6–8 minutes, turning occasionally until the bread is crispy.
Step 5: Serve
Cut the Aryes into wedges and serve hot with tahini sauce, yogurt dip, and fresh vegetables.
Tips for Perfect Aryes
Use thin layers of meat
Thin filling ensures the meat cooks evenly.
Choose soft pita bread
Fresh pita prevents cracking during stuffing.
Cook until crispy
The crispy bread texture is key to authentic Aryes.
Add cheese for variation
Some versions include mozzarella or halloumi for extra flavor.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
What is Aryes?
Aryes is a Middle Eastern dish where pita bread is stuffed with spiced minced meat and grilled or baked until crispy.
What meat is best for Aryes?
Traditionally lamb is used, but beef or a mix of beef and lamb also works well.
Can Aryes be cooked in an air fryer?
Yes. Cook at 190°C (375°F) for about 10–12 minutes until crispy.
Can Aryes be prepared ahead of time?
Yes. You can prepare the stuffed pitas in advance and refrigerate them for up to 24 hours before cooking.
How should Aryes be served?
Aryes is typically served hot with tahini sauce, yogurt dip, and fresh vegetables.
